Rodri says City must leave St James’ Park with three points on Saturday – but is expecting a stiff battle against Newcastle United.
The Magpies have made steady progress under Steve Bruce over the past few months and have already beaten Tottenham and United this season.


Mindful of the Blues’ surprising losses to Norwich and Wolves, Rodri says the champions must be at their best to head home with maximum points.
I think it is going to be a tough game,” said the Spain international.

“They are so strong; they are one of those very English teams, so we are going to do our best.
“We obviously need three points to stay in touch with the leaders and we don’t need to see that they beat United to know that they are a good team.
